THREE-DIMENSIONAL MULTIOBECTIVE CONSTRAINED OPTIMIZATION OF AERODYNAMIC SHAPES

S. Peigin, B. Epstein
Israel Aircraft Industries, The Academic College of Tel-Aviv, Yaffo, Israel

Keywords: constarined optimization, geneteic Algorithm, Navier-Stokes driver, parallel computations

A robust and efficient approach to the multipoint constrained design is extended to optimization of 3D aerodynamic wings. The objective is to minimize the total drag at fixed lift in the presence of various geometrical and aerodynamic constraints, including the constraint on the pitching moment. For the considered class of problems, significant aerodynamic gains have been obtained.
